House panel subpoenas AG Bondi for Epstein probe deposition
Investing.com -- The U.S. House Oversight panel issued a subpoena for Attorney General Pam Bondi to provide a deposition as part of its investigation into late convicted sex criminal Jeffrey Epstein, the panel announced on Tuesday.
Bondi and her deputy are scheduled to give panel members a private briefing on Wednesday, according to the panel's statement.
